Writer for children—reader forever…that’s Vivian Kirkfield in five words. Her bucket list contains many more than five words – but she’s already checked off skydiving, parasailing, banana-boat riding, walking under the ocean, and visiting kid-lit friends all around the world. When she isn’t looking for ways to fall from the sky or sink under the water, she can be found writing picture books in the quaint village of Bedford, NH where the old library is her favorite hangout and her young grandson is her favorite board game partner. A retired kindergarten teacher with a master's in Early Childhood Education, Vivian inspires budding writers during classroom visits and shares insights with aspiring authors at conferences and on her blog, Picture Books Help Kids Soar where she hosts the #50PreciousWords International Writing Contest and #50PreciousWordsforKids Challenge, as well as a Literacy Initiative that has already donated almost 700 brand-new children's books to local schools in need. Her titles have garnered accolades and awards including Best Stem Book K-12, Social Studies Notable Trade Book, Silver Eureka Honor, Junior Library Guild Selection, and have appeared on lists such as Children's Book Council, A Mighty Girl, and PJLibrary. She is the author of Pippa’s Passover Plate (Holiday House); Four Otters Toboggan: An Animal Counting Book (Pomegranate); Sweet Dreams, Sarah: From Slavery to Inventor (Creston Books); Making Their Voices Heard: The Inspiring Friendship of Ella Fitzgerald and Marilyn Monroe (Little Bee Books), and From Here to There: Inventions That Changed the Way the World Moves (Houghton Mifflin Harcourt), and the upcoming Pedal, Balance, Steer: Annie Londonderry, the First Woman to Cycle Around the World (Calkins Creek/Astra Books for Young Readers, February 20, 2024) and One Girl's Voice: How Lucy Stone Changed the Law of the Land (Calkins Creek/Astra Books for Young Readers, Spring 2025).
